>On Fri 12 Nov 2004 12:17 PM, M. A. Imam wrote:
>> I am new to linux. i am working on my thesis... i have made some changes to
>> net/ipv4/tcp.c now i need to remake my kernel. right?
>
>If you are running Linux 2.6, you only need to run `make` again. The Linux
>build-script will detect the changes, because of a changed timestamp.
